Vista API Overview

The Vista API is a RESTful API that has resource-oriented URLs, returns JSON-encoded responses, and uses standard HTTP response codes, authentication, and verbs. The API is designed with a logical view of the data points that exist within the various Vista modules, mirroring the folder structure of the Vista database.

The Vista API will affect the Vista data tied to a given set of API keys, which you use to authenticate a request. You may have different API keys for your Vista production and test instances.

Before you begin making API calls, familiarize yourself with forms, settings, default behaviors, and customizations in Vista.
